Who owns Versailles Palace today?
The Palace of Versailles is currently owned by the French state. Its formal title is the Public Establishment of the Palace, Museum and National Estate of Versailles. Since 1995, it has been run as a Public Establishment, with an independent administration and management supervised by the French Ministry of Culture.How Much It Would Cost to Build Famous Landmarks Today

Each room and suite is a uniquely designed and decorated ode to 18th-century palace style. Rates at Airelles Château de Versailles, Le Grand Contrôle start at $2,077 per night and include a dedicated butler, daily tours of the Château de Versailles, breakfast, and afternoon tea.Can you rent a room in the Palace of Versailles?
